![]() It serves as the site for the emergence of cranial nerves VIII-XII, which supply the head, face, and viscera. The information relayed from the cerebrum and the cerebellum to the body must traverse the brain stem. It plays an important role in the conduction of information. Conveyance of sensory and motor pathways from the body to the brain and from the brain back to the body is also a function of the brain stem. It functions in regulating the body’s sleep cycle. Motor and sensory supply is provided to the neck and face region by the brain stem through the cranial nerves. It contains regions for control of many body functions like swallowing, heart rate control, respiration. The main function of the brain stem is in regulating respiratory and cardiac activities. It is located at the base of the brain between the spinal cord and the deep structure of the cerebral hemisphere. There are four main areas in the brain: The cerebrum (the outer layer is called the cerebral cortex), which is split into two. It is the posterior component of the brain and comprises parts of the midbrain and the hindbrain. It is made up of three regions: midbrain, pons, and medulla oblongata. It is the structure of the brain that is connected with the spinal cord. It regulates the blood vessel diameter, heartbeat, normal breathing rhythm and also controls the reflexes of sneezing, vomiting, hiccupping, and coughing. It extends from the pons and is interconnected with the spinal cord. Medulla oblongata forms the basal region of the brain stem. It comprises the fibers and nuclei of the nerves that serve in facial muscle strength, eye muscle control, and other functions. Pons serves as a connection between the midbrain and the medulla oblongata. The midbrain is associated with alertness, temperature control, and motor activities. A network of synaptic neurons comprises the tegmentum. The tectum forms the dorsal side of the midbrain. Two pairs of superior colliculi and the posterior colliculi together comprise the tectum. Midbrain includes the tectum and tegmentum. Midbrain is represented by a pair of longitudinal bands of nervous tissue, crura cerebri on the ventral side and dorsally a pair of small swellings called corpora bigemina on either side. Midbrain forms the starting point of the brain stem. The essential working of the brain stem is in regulating respiratory and cardiac activities. It forms a connection of the brain and the spinal cord. The brain stem is the structure of the brain that is continuous with the spinal cord.
